ATI announces latest Catalyst drivers for Microsoft Windows Vista

10/09/2006
AnimationXpress Team

Coinciding with the release of Microsoft Windows Vista Release Candidate 1 (RC1), ATI Technologies Inc., announced on September 8 06 that it is ready for the forthcoming public launch of Microsoft Corp.’s operating system, as demonstrated by new Catalyst drivers available now.

ATI’s latest drivers for Windows Vista improve on the leading stability and performance found in previous versions, and introduce new features such as ATI’s Powerplay power management technology for improved battery life for mobile platforms. When combined with ATI’s graphics processors, ATI’s drivers enable the fullest possible experience today for Windows Vista(1).

“With today’s release, ATI is demonstrating that its graphics hardware and software are ready to provide the best experience possible for users of Windows Vista,” said Mike Sievert, Corporate Vice President for Windows Client Marketing at Microsoft. “ATI has played an important role to ensure the public can take advantage of extremely stable, feature-rich, high performance drivers that showcase the capabilities of Windows Vista.”

“ATI continues to introduce shipping-caliber drivers for Windows Vista that improve on the stability, performance and feature set of versions past,” said Ben Bar-Haim, vice president of Software Engineering, ATI Technologies. “The quality of ATI’s drivers’ ensure that upon the release of Windows Vista, OEMs, system integrators, businesses and consumers can take advantage of the best experience Windows Vista has to offer.”

ATI’s latest Catalyst drivers for Microsoft Windows Vista are available for download from the ATI website at www.ati.com.
